Wood Siding Replacement in Norwalk, CT
Wood siding replacement services involve removing damaged, rotting, or outdated wood siding and installing new panels to improve both the appearance and durability of a property's exterior. These projects typically address issues such as weather-related wear, insect damage, or the need to update the style of the home’s facade. Homeowners often seek this service to enhance curb appeal, prevent further structural problems, or increase the overall value of the property. Before requesting wood siding replacement,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, the types of wood siding available, and the maintenance requirements for different materials.
Property owners should consider the condition of their current siding and whether replacement is necessary or if repairs might suffice. It’s important to evaluate the compatibility of new siding with existing exterior elements and to understand any preparation or finishing work that may be required. Additionally, understanding the differences between various wood siding options-such as cedar, pine, or engineered wood-and their respective costs, longevity, and aesthetic qualities can help inform the decision-making process. Clear communication about project expectations and material choices ensures the replacement aligns with the desired look and functional needs of the home.

Common Wood Siding Replacement Jobs
Wood Siding Replacement - restores the appearance and integrity of damaged or rotted siding.
Board and Batten Siding - replaces vertical siding with durable, traditional wood panels.
Shingle Siding - updates the exterior with replacement of worn or damaged wood shingles.
Log Siding - replaces aged or cracked log siding to maintain rustic charm.
Horizontal Lap Siding - refreshes the exterior with new, evenly spaced wood lap siding.
Custom Wood Siding - provides tailored replacement options to match existing architectural styles.
Wood Siding Replacement Questions
What types of wood siding are available for replacement projects? Common options include cedar, redwood, and pine, each offering different appearances and durability levels suited to various preferences.
How can I tell if my wood siding needs to be replaced? Signs include rotting, warping, cracking, or extensive pest damage, which can compromise the siding’s integrity and appearance.
What are the benefits of replacing old wood siding? Replacement can improve curb appeal, increase weather resistance, and enhance the overall protection of the property.
What should property owners consider before choosing wood siding replacement? Factors include the siding style, maintenance requirements, and compatibility with the building’s existing exterior design.
